I'm trying to create a dropdown based on the following query:

index=MyApp tgtHostname=$tgtHostname$

The form is there and the default value of "any" seems to work. However the dropdown is not populated. Any idea why? Thanks.

<form>
  <label>My form search</label>
  <searchTemplate>index=MyApp tgtHostname=$tgtHostname$</searchTemplate>

  <fieldset>
    <input type="dropdown" token="tgtHostname">
       <label>Select the hostname</label>
       <populatingSearch fieldForValue="tgtHostname" fieldForLabel="tgtHostname"><![CDATA[index=MyApp tgtHostname=$tgtHostname$]]></populatingSearch>
     <default>somehost.somedomain.com</default>
     <choice value="*">Any</choice>
    </input>
  </fieldset>

  <row>
   <table>
     <title>Host Names</title>
     <option name="showPager">true</option>
   </table>
   </row>
</form>

<form>
<label>My form search</label> 
<searchTemplate>index=MyApp tgtHostname=$tgtHostname$</searchTemplate> 
<fieldset> 
 <input type="dropdown" token="tgtHostname"> 
   <label>Select the hostname</label> 
     <populatingSearch fieldForValue="tgtHostname" fieldForLabel="tgtHostname"><![CDATA[index=MyApp | stats count by tgtHostname]]></populatingSearch> 
     <default>somehost.somedomain.com</default> 
     <choice value="*">Any</choice> 
 </input> 
</fieldset> 
<row> 
<title>Host Names</title> 
<option name="showPager">true</option>
</row> 
</form>

Watch your syntax as well. It's not shown here since the code sample widget didn't work for me, but make sure you have an upper Case T in searchTemplate, Uppercase F and L in fieldForLabel and uppercase F and V in fieldForValue
